🌐 The blockchain world is evolving, and @dusk_foundation is at the forefront with its privacy-centric Layer 1 protocol built for regulated finance and real-world asset tokenization. At its core, $DUSK powers a unique network that leverages zero-knowledge cryptography to enable confidential smart contracts and selective data disclosure — offering complete privacy while still supporting compliance with regulatory frameworks like MiCA and GDPR. This balance of confidentiality and transparency makes #Dusk ideal for institutional DeFi, tokenized securities, confidential payments, and programmable compliance in on-chain markets. With modular architecture such as DuskDS for settlement and DuskEVM for EVM-compatible execution, developers can build scalable, private applications with familiar tooling. The recent launch of the DuskEVM testnet invites builders to explore deploying contracts and bridging $DUSK across layers ahead of mainnet, accelerating ecosystem growth and innovation in privacy-aware blockchain technology. Article: Walrus and the Future of Decentralized Data Infrastructure
As blockchain adoption accelerates, one challenge continues to surface across DeFi, NFTs, gaming, and AI: reliable and scalable data storage. This is where Walrus steps in as a next-generation decentralized data availability and storage protocol designed for Web3’s real demands. Unlike traditional onchain storage solutions that struggle with cost and performance, Walrus focuses on efficiency, composability, and long-term sustainability. At its core, Walrus enables applications to store large amounts of data in a decentralized way without sacrificing speed or security. This is critical for use cases such as NFT metadata, onchain gaming assets, AI datasets, and historical blockchain data. By separating data availability from execution, Walrus allows developers to build richer applications while keeping costs predictable and performance high. The ecosystem around @Walrus 🦭/acc is also designed with incentives in mind. The native token, $WAL , plays a key role in securing the network, aligning participants, and ensuring that data remains available over time. Token incentives encourage honest behavior from storage providers while giving users confidence that their data is protected and retrievable. What makes Walrus particularly exciting is its vision of becoming a foundational layer for Web3 data. As more applications require scalable storage that integrates seamlessly with smart contracts, protocols like Walrus will be essential infrastructure rather than optional tools. In the long run, decentralized data solutions are not just about storage—they are about ownership, censorship resistance, and trust minimization. For builders, investors, and users looking toward the next phase of blockchain innovation, Walrus represents a critical piece of the puzzle. With strong technical foundations, a clear use case, and an expanding ecosystem, #Walrus and $WAL are well positioned to support the data-driven future of Web3.
